
Spelman College's associate professor of biology
Tiffany Oliver, Ph.D., is extremely passionate about scientific innovation and embodies Spelman's commitment to faculty excellence and undergraduate research.
A published leader in the fields of genetics and genetic epidemiology, she has served as a collaborator on numerous studies, reviewed articles for popular scientific journals, and served on review panels for government agencies such as the National Science Foundation (NSF), the Department of Defense (DoD) and the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A).
